The New York Times published an article Wednesday that framed the recent kidnapping and torturing of a handicapped white man at the hands of four black Chicagoans as possibly being done by white Donald Trump supporters.

Three 18-year-olds and one 24-year-old were arrested last Wednesday for kidnapping and torturing 18-year-old Austin Hilbourn. They broadcast the torture, which included cutting Hilbourn and making the disabled man drink toilet water, on Facebook Live. The broadcast included them shouting “fuck white people” and “fuck Donald Trump.”

If you read The New York Times’ editorial board’s story on “This Week in Hate” you wouldn’t have had a clue about what actually occurred. The story said: “Four people have been charged with a hate crime, among other charges, in the beating in Chicago of a teenager with mental disabilities, which was broadcast on Facebook Live on January 3. The video shows one of the suspects shouting about Donald Trump and ‘white people.'”

The races are ambiguous and the editorial board didn’t detail whether the suspects supported Trump and white people or not. The reader is just informed that a teenager with mental disabilities was beaten on camera.
